Anti-Reflective (AR) Thin Film Multilayer Optical Coatings

AccuCoat Inc. offers a wide range of high efficiency broadband, narrowband and dual-band Anti-Reflective (AR) coatings. Many standard anti-reflective coatings are available on glass and plastic (polymer) substrates. Custom designed solutions are also available. Our coatings have been tested to meet Military Specifications, High Laser Damage Threshold tests (LDT) and are finding their way into many new Solar applications. 

Substrate Materials: These Anti-reflective (AR) coatings can be applied to glass, plastic, and crystals. 

Durability: Meets adhesion, abrasion, temperature, humidity, salt and solubility of various Military and ISO specifications. 

Cleaning: These optical coatings  are able to be cleaned with alcohol, acetone (not plastic) and mild soap solutions.

Typical Applications: Bar-Code Scanners, Displays, Cameras, Fiber Optics, Lasers, Illumination Systems, Range Finders, Instrumentation, Microscopes.

Industries Served: Medical, Telecommunications, Industrial, Display, Military, Machine Vision, Aerospace, Lighting, Photographic, University, Security, Imaging, Scanning.

 

AC100 Multilayer AR Coating

Multilayer A/R Coating (Vis) AC100
Broadband A/R coating for the visible region
0.5% Reflection average in the visible region (450nm - 650nm)

AC145 Multilayer AR Coating (Vis-NIR)

Multilayer AR Coatings (Vis-NIR) AC145
Broadband AR coating for the visible-NIR region. 0.5% Reflection average in the region (400nm – 900nm)

AC110 Multilayer AR Coating on Zeonex

Multilayer AR Coatings on Zeonex AC110
Broadband AR coating for the visible region
0.5% Reflection average in the visible region (450nm - 650nm)

AC150 Multilayer AR Coating (Telcom)

Multilayer A/R Coating (Telcom) AC150
Broadband A/R coating. Less than 0.3% Absolute Reflection from 1250nm - 1650nm. Less than 0.1% Reflection at 1310nm and 1550nm.

Single Layer A/R Coating AC120
Single layer of SiO2 or MgF2. Offers limited scratch resistance & A/R function. Typically 2% Reflection average in the visible region (450nm - 650nm)

AC155 AR Coating on Silicon Wafer

AR Coatings on Silicon Wafer AC155
Abs R < 0.25% @ 1550nm. R avg. < 0.5% 1480nm-1650nm

AC130 AR Coating (V-Coat)

AR Coatings (V-Coat) AC130
Optimized for single wavelengths (i.e. 633nm, 1064nm, 1550nm). Typically less than 0.25% Reflection at the specified wavelength

AC160 Multilayer AR Coating (NIR)

Multilayer A/R Coating (NIR) AC160
Broadband A/R coating for the NIR region
0.5% Reflection average in the region (900nm – 1700nm)

AC140 High Efficiency AR Coating (Vis)

High Efficiency A/R Coating (Vis) AC140
Lowest possible reflection and wide bandwidth A/R. Typically 0.5% Absolute Reflection from 425nm - 675nm.

AC170 Dual Point AR Coating

Dual Point AR Coatings AC170 Two point AR coating for the visible and NIR region. 0.5% Reflection at both points (632nm & 1064nm)
